前提・実現したいこと
マクロを作成しているブックのワークシートSheet1のC2C6の値を一覧.xlsxというファイルの1枚目のシートのB4B8に転記したいです。
以下のコードを実行すると、インデックスに有効範囲がありません とエラーが表示されます。
しかし、稀にエラーが起きずに転記できる時もあるのですが原因がわかりません。
発生している問題・エラーメッセージ
インデックスに有効範囲がありません
該当のソースコード
VBA
1Workbooks("一覧.xlsx").Sheets(1).Range("B4") _ 2= Worksheets("Sheet1").Range("C2") 3Workbooks("一覧.xlsx").Sheets(1).Range("B5") _ 4= Worksheets("Sheet1").Range("C3") 5Workbooks("一覧.xlsx").Sheets(1).Range("B6") _ 6= Worksheets("Sheet1").Range("C4") 7Workbooks("一覧.xlsx").Sheets(1).Range("B7") _ 8= Worksheets("Sheet1").Range("C5") 9Workbooks("一覧.xlsx").Sheets(1).Range("B8") _ 10= Worksheets("Sheet1").Range("C6")
回答2件
あなたの回答
tips
プレビュー
バッドをするには、ログインかつ
こちらの条件を満たす必要があります。